Anthony James Cafiero{{Cite news|date=1982-10-02|title=Anthony J. Cafiero Dies at 82; Judge and Legislator in Jersey (Published 1982)|language=en-US|work=The New York Times|url=https://www.nytimes.com/1982/10/02/obituaries/anthony-j-cafiero-dies-at-82-judge-and-legislator-in-jersey.html|access-date=2021-02-18|issn=0362-4331}} (February 11, 1900 – September 28, 1982) was a member of the New Jersey Senate from 1949 to 1953.

He was born in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, the son of a local barber.{{Cite web|title=The Political Graveyard: Lawyer Politicians in New Jersey, C|url=http://politicalgraveyard.com/geo/NJ/lawyer.C.html|access-date=2021-02-18|website=politicalgraveyard.com}}{{Cite web|title=Anthony Cafiero in Social Security Death Index|url=https://www.fold3.com/record/15927602-anthony-cafiero-social-security-death-index|access-date=2021-02-18|website=Fold3|language=en}} Cafiero moved to North Wildwood, New Jersey, in 1921.{{Cite web|title=Anthony J. Cafiero – CAFIERO LAW, P.A. {{!}} Cape May County, NJ Attorneys|url=https://cafierolaw.com/anthony-j-cafiero/|access-date=2021-02-18|language=en-US}} He was the Cape May County prosecutor from 1944 to 1946, and was a county judge in Cape May County from 1946 to 1948. He was a member of the New Jersey Senate, representing Cape May County as a Republican, from 1948 to 1954. He served in the New Jersey Superior Court from 1954 until retiring in 1970. A resident of Middle Township, New Jersey, he died on September 28, 1982, at Burdette Tomlin Memorial Hospital.

Family

He married Hazel Koenig in 1926. Their son, James Cafiero, served in the New Jersey Senate and General Assembly.
